Saint Ann Maronite Church Lebanese Festival • September 15
The Annual Lebanese Festival will be held September 15 at Saint Ann Maronite Church in West Scranton. Celebrating many decades of Lebanese culture, the festival features delicious cuisine such as tabbouleh, hummus, grape leaves, spinach pies, pastries, kibbeh and other Lebanese cuisine. The festival brings together generations of parishioners and community members to connect and learn more about the rich heritage of Lebanese culture in Scranton, which originated more than 100 years ago when a large group of Lebanese families settled in the area in 1903. “Preparing for the festival is a lot of hard work, but there’s still time for fun and laughter,” says Reverend Anton Youssef (Father Tony). “We all come together for this occasion.” The event will run Sunday from noon to 7 p.m. Call (570) 344-2129.

Dynamic Energy completes almost-1-MW rooftop solar project in Pennsylvania
Dynamic Energy has completed a 907-kW commercial rooftop solar project with Cooper-Booth Wholesale Co., a full-service distributor for convenience store merchandise in the Mid-Atlantic. Situated on 61,000 ft2 of industrial rooftop located at the company’s Mountville, Pennsylvania warehouse and headquarters, the project will offset Cooper-Booth’s rising energy costs while driving the company’s green energy initiatives.
